KomputerPemrograman

Aplikasi mobile membuat kedua untuk iPhone dan Android sendiri?

aplikasi mobile dapat membuat tidak hanya perusahaan yang sangat khusus dengan programmer, tetapi juga pengguna biasa. alat apa yang dapat mereka gunakan untuk tujuan ini? Apa yang harus memperhatikan pengembangan perangkat lunak sendiri untuk perangkat mobile?

Tujuan Aplikasi Mobile

Sebelum mempertimbangkan bahwa, dengan bantuan beberapa alat yang dikembangkan aplikasi mobile, cara membuat mereka, mari kita mempelajarinya, pada kenyataannya, apa yang bisa menjadi tujuan pembebasan mereka atas dasar itu, apa tujuan dari keputusan yang relevan. aplikasi mobile dapat diklasifikasikan ke dalam varietas utama sebagai berikut:

- informasi;

- transaksi;

- komunikasi;

- versi mobile dari perangkat lunak komputer - editor, pemirsa, browser;

- aplikasi analitis dan perencana;

- solusi pembelajaran.

Sebenarnya, permainan juga adalah aplikasi mobile, tapi paling sering mereka diasingkan software. Kami akan mempelajari secara lebih rinci apa aplikasi mobile yang ditandai, bagaimana membuat mereka tunduk pada biaya mungkin.

informasi aplikasi

Inti dari aplikasi informasi - untuk memberikan pengguna mereka dengan akses ke beberapa informasi yang berguna, berita. Sebuah contoh dari keputusan yang tepat - aplikasi dari produsen pakaian atau alas kaki, yang menginformasikan pengguna tentang diskon dan penawaran khusus dari perusahaan ini. Ini mungkin sebuah katalog ponsel atau brosur dalam format yang sesuai.

Buat iOS mobile atau aplikasi Android di varietas yang sesuai mungkin adalah cara termudah. fakta bahwa dasar untuk perangkat lunak jenis ini dapat berupa, misalnya, sudah berjalan website perusahaan atau versi mobile-nya. Cukuplah untuk beradaptasi antarmuka dan diimplementasikan dalam mekanisme komunikasi untuk algoritma perangkat lunak untuk sistem operasi mobile - yang, dengan bantuan beberapa alat itu bisa dilakukan, kita akan mempertimbangkan lebih lanjut, dan aplikasi seluler siap.

aplikasi transaksional

aplikasi transaksional dirancang untuk pembayaran berbagai barang dan jasa yang dibeli melalui Internet. jenis perangkat lunak dapat dikeluarkan oleh bank, sistem pembayaran. Perlu dicatat bahwa yang paling rumit dalam struktur dan kode - dalam banyak kasus itu adalah aplikasi mobile transaksional. Cara membuat mereka dan, yang paling penting, untuk beradaptasi dengan persyaratan hukum, tahu hanya yang paling sangat terampil.

Oleh karena itu, jika pengguna tidak memiliki keterampilan tersebut - baik dalam hal memecahkan masalah teknis dan memastikan kepatuhan dengan persyaratan penerapan hukum - bahwa keputusan seperti itu saja harus, jika mereka mengembangkan, ini terutama untuk tujuan informasi, dalam perjalanan pembelajaran. Pengenalan perkembangan tersebut, dalam prakteknya, membutuhkan waktu tambahan dan dalam banyak kasus biaya tambahan.

aplikasi komunikasi

Aplikasi komunikasi - ini adalah program yang dirancang untuk memungkinkan komunikasi antara pengguna menggunakan sumber daya pihak ketiga pengembang, atau merek. Menciptakan solusi mirip dengan, seperti dalam kasus aplikasi transaksional, sulit. Sekali lagi, masuk akal untuk melakukannya terutama ketika ada kemauan pada prinsipnya belajar untuk mengembangkan jenis yang sesuai produk. Tapi diperkenalkan dalam praktek akan membutuhkan sumber daya yang signifikan, yang berada di pembuangan dari beberapa pengguna pribadi.

Cara di mana data tertanam aplikasi mobile, bagaimana menciptakan kondisi untuk kinerja yang stabil mereka, dalam banyak kasus hanya tahu spesialis yang sangat berkualitas. Tapi, tentu saja, seorang programmer yang terampil, siap untuk menghabiskan banyak waktu dan investasi, pada prinsipnya, dapat mengembangkan struktur sederhana, tetapi permintaan dalam pandangan kesederhanaan dan kenyamanan dari utusan kecil atau jaringan sosial.

Namun, mereka bersaing dengan "Skype", "Vkontakte" atau Viber, mungkin tidak akan. Oleh karena itu, pada tahap perencanaan pengembangan pengembang aplikasi tradisional harus realistis mengenai prospek penarikan produk ke pasar.

versi mobile dari software PC

Editor, pemirsa, browser - aplikasi yang analog atau serupa dalam fungsi dengan keputusan yang relevan dari terlibat pengguna PC tradisional. Tapi, tentu saja, tidak hanya dapat mereka memiliki rekan-rekan yang disesuaikan untuk berjalan di PC. Bahkan, setiap jenis aplikasi dalam klasifikasi kita bisa komputer. Namun, solusi dianggap - termasuk yang belum menjadi akrab dengan pengguna sebelum pasar teknologi komputer mulai muncul en smartphone secara massal dan tablet. Oleh karena itu, jenis yang sesuai dari program aslinya, sebagai suatu peraturan, itu disajikan dalam versi disesuaikan dengan menjalankannya pada PC, dan hanya pada fakta penampilan di pasar smartphone dan tablet yang dirancang sebagai versi mobile.

Cara membuat aplikasi mobile untuk jenis Android atau iOS yang tepat sendiri, itu tergantung terutama pada apakah asli - komputer, versi lisensi perangkat lunak atau didistribusikan sebagai perangkat lunak bebas, open source memiliki. Dalam kasus pertama, menciptakan versi mobile dari program dalam kebanyakan kasus memerlukan persetujuan dari pemilik. Dan jika mereka menolak untuk mengizinkan pengembangan versi yang tepat dari perangkat lunak, versi mobile-nya, bahkan jika pengguna itu atas inisiatifnya sendiri, kemungkinan akan diakui sebagai ilegal. Dalam hal perangkat lunak asli adalah open source, kemudian mengembangkan versi untuk perangkat mobile - sebuah pertanyaan dari teknik.

software analitis dan penjadwal

aplikasi analitik dan perencana memungkinkan survei statistik yang berbeda, membentuk anggaran, jadwal janji, dll Dapat dicatat bahwa segmen ini aplikasi mobile - .. Termasuk yang di mana pengembang swasta biasanya menawarkan kebebasan terbesar dari tindakan. Tidak banyak merek yang tahu cara membuat aplikasi mobile untuk Android atau iOS jenis yang sesuai jauh lebih baik daripada itu akan membuat pengembang swasta. Hal yang paling penting dalam keputusan tersebut - sebuah konsep. perkembangannya terutama tergantung pada keterampilan tertentu programmer, desainer, spesialis keuangan, dan adalah mungkin bahwa pendekatan yang diusulkan oleh mereka akan terbukti lebih efektif daripada yang akan dikembangkan oleh sebuah perusahaan besar.

tutorial

Sama, pada prinsipnya, dapat dikatakan tentang program-program pelatihan yang dirancang untuk perangkat mobile. Mereka dimaksudkan untuk memfasilitasi pengembangan pengguna tertentu bahasa, standar, keterampilan. pengembang swasta mungkin menawarkan pengguna jenis yang sesuai dari solusi, lebih nyaman dan efisien dibandingkan dengan apa yang dapat dibuat oleh sebuah perusahaan besar.

Pengembangan aplikasi mobile mereka sendiri: pada struktur

Cara membuat aplikasi mobile Anda sendiri? Agar berhasil memecahkan masalah ini pengembang yang pertama harus menentukan struktur yang optimal untuk membuat program untuk perangkat mobile. Terlepas dari sebagaimana dimaksud, akan terdiri dari dua komponen utama: modul front-end dan back-end. Yang pertama adalah interface yang kemungkinan aplikasi akan melibatkan pengguna. Modul kedua bertanggung jawab untuk menerima dan mengirimkan data dalam reaksi dari perangkat lunak yang sesuai dan user (dalam beberapa kasus - sebagai pengembang, jika, misalnya, pada bagian yang diperlukan penyediaan update tertentu atau umpan balik).

Apa yang bisa menjadi antarmuka aplikasi?

karakteristik yang lebih rinci dari aplikasi mobile tergantung pada struktur pengangkatan mereka. Sebagai contoh, jika Anda membuat sebuah sistem informasi pada toko online, itu bisa hadir dalam antarmuka:

- pilihan navigasi dengan bantuan yang pengguna dapat memperoleh akses ke data tertentu;

- Unit umpan balik dengan penjual atau pemasok;

- Members Area, yang akan tercermin pada data pengguna memintanya membeli;

- blok berita, yang akan diposting informasi tentang diskon dan penawaran khusus toko online, serta informasi lain yang relevan.

Ada kemungkinan bahwa pemilik toko akan lebih baik untuk membuat situs aplikasi mobile, mengulangi dulu struktur untuk pengguna yang sudah hidup akrab, dengan tidak ada masalah dapat menemukan jalan mereka dalam struktur perangkat lunak yang relevan untuk perangkat mobile.

Pengembangan Aplikasi Mobile: Alat

Kita sekarang mempelajari nuansa sejumlah solusi pengembangan praktis dipertimbangkan. Pertanyaan tentang cara membuat aplikasi mobile yang dapat diselesaikan dengan bantuan desainer user-friendly yang memasarkan perangkat lunak yang sesuai disajikan dalam jumlah cukup besar. Secara khusus, perhatikan solusi seperti: MobiCart, BusinessApps, My-Apps, Net2Share. Semuanya disajikan dalam format perangkat lunak awan, dan Anda dapat mengaksesnya dari perangkat apapun melalui Internet. Mempertimbangkan bagaimana untuk membuat aplikasi mobile, peluang memanfaatkan program-program ini secara lebih rinci.

Alat untuk mengembangkan aplikasi: MobiCart

Layanan ini dapat berguna untuk pemilik toko online hanya yang sama jika ia awalnya tidak website sendiri. Dengan pengembang MobiCart dapat membuat aplikasi fungsional, di mana pengguna akan dapat membangun berbagai komunikasi dengan vendor: membuat reservasi, membayar untuk mereka, mendapatkan informasi tentang diskon, hubungi pemasok.

Fungsi utama dari layanan tersebut disediakan secara komersial, tetapi menjadi akrab dengan fitur-fiturnya dan pengembang dapat mengisi.

Alat untuk membuat aplikasi mobile: BusinessApps

aplikasi konstruktor ini dioptimalkan terutama untuk toko online kecil. Hal ini memungkinkan Anda untuk menerapkan:

- interface untuk pesan, menambahkan produk ke keranjang;

- Organisasi negosiasi antara pemasok dan pembeli barang;

- integrasi dengan jejaring sosial;

- blok berita.

Perlu dicatat bahwa perancang aplikasi memungkinkan Anda untuk menggunakan template untuk membuat aplikasi yang disesuaikan untuk perusahaan yang mewakili bidang bisnis yang spesifik, seperti katering, kebugaran. layanan pelaporan ini tidak gratis, biaya lisensi untuk itu adalah 59 dolar per bulan. Namun, Anda dapat menggunakan versi trial. Selain itu, jika pengguna tidak menyukai desainer, mungkin memerlukan pengembalian dana yang dibayarkan kembali.

Pengembangan Aplikasi Tools: My-Apps

Konstruktor ini, pada gilirannya, gratis. Masalah "cara membuat aplikasi mobile untuk iPhone atau Android penggunaannya" dapat diselesaikan dengan melibatkan 10 template yang disesuaikan untuk komunikasi dengan bisnis konsumen dalam berbagai bidang usaha. Di antara fitur yang paling menonjol dari layanan dianggap - publikasi yang cepat dari aplikasi di direktori utama - App Store dan Google Play.

Pengembangan Aplikasi Tools: Net2Share

Dilihat desainer - di antara solusi yang paling nyaman untuk cepat memahami bagaimana untuk membuat aplikasi mobile untuk Android Anda sendiri. sumber daya ini diadaptasi sama untuk pengembangan produk pada platform yang relevan. Hal ini ditandai dengan cukup berbagai fungsi, serta kemampuan untuk mendapatkan untuk membuat aplikasi dengan bantuan layanan iklan internal. Artinya, pengguna dapat, dengan mengembangkan produk tertentu, meng-upload ke akun perusahaan. Selain itu, para pengembang yang paling aktif mendapatkan profil gratis di Google Play.

Selain itu, perusahaan Net2Share mengadakan kursus pelatihan gratis bagi pengguna, berkat partisipasi di mana pengembang dapat meningkatkan keterampilan mereka untuk pendirian, serta promosi dari aplikasi di pasar.

Tentu saja, ada banyak layanan khusus lainnya, yang memungkinkan untuk membuat game aplikasi mobile. Dalam banyak kasus, pengembang mungkin sebaiknya menjadi layanan cloud, dan distribusi, yang memungkinkan untuk melaksanakan satu atau kode lain. Tapi kita telah dibahas di atas sumber daya yang dirancang terutama untuk pengguna dengan pengalaman minimal dan dapat dioperasikan bahkan tanpa pelatihan khusus. Mereka serbaguna dan memungkinkan pengembang untuk membuat aplikasi yang dioptimalkan untuk berbagai bidang.

Similar articles

 

 

 

 

Trending Now

 

 

 

 

Newest

Copyright © 2018 id.atomiyme.com. Theme powered by WordPress.